Robert S. Greenlee, 65, Carroll Township, passed away Tuesday, Jan. 15, 2019, in his home. A son of the late S. Carl and Erma Walker Greenlee, he was born in Livingston, Mont., on July 20, 1953. Rob attended the Calvary Bible Church in Charleroi. He had been an emergency responder in many capacities in Washington County since 1972, originally joining the fire service in Waynesburg as a young teenager. For the past 15 years, he was the fire chief of the Volunteer Fire Department of Carroll Township and served for the past two decades as Carroll Township’s emergency management coordinator. Prior to his tenure at Carroll Township he had been a member of the Webster, Fallowfield Township, Washington Township and the Waynesburg Volunteer Fire Departments. During the 1970s and 80s, he was a paramedic supervisor for the Washington Ambulance and Chair Company. He was a gold medal skating coach in the United States Association of Roller Skating and coached speed skating, taking his team to National Competitions in both 2001 and 2002. He was also a member of the Warrior Trail in Greene County. In his spare time, he was an avid Nascar fan and golfer. For over 20 years, he sold fire equipment for Premier Safety and truly enjoyed helping struggling fire departments. He loved his family, children, grandchildren and grand-doggies. Survivors include his wife, Terri Hamilton Greenlee, with whom he would have celebrated 35 years of marriage on Feb. 2, 2019; three daughters and a son-in-law, Jessica Lynn and Michael Clark of Forward Township, Megan Beth Greenlee of Carroll Township and Joy Anna Greenlee of Charleroi; two sons and daughters-in-law, Carl Scott and Alyson Greenlee of Carroll Township and Brett Robert and Alexandra Greenlee of Monongahela; two grandchildren, Rebecca Rose Clark and Barrett Scott Greenlee and one “on the way.” In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by a brother, John Greenlee, in infancy.
